To exclude SARS-CoV-2 infection, additional rapid antigen testing may be necessary.

Published Date: 05 Jul 2023

In order to rule out SARS-CoV-2 infection, it may be necessary to repeat testing with a rapid antigen test (Ag-RDT) every 48 hours, according to a prospective cohort study. So, those who are undergoing SARS-CoV-2 testing should engage in physical activity.
